The dog days are over for one shiba inu—he’s enjoying his golden years hanging out at home and maybe even improving his backgammon game.

Last year, a video of Shiba-San the shiba inu manning a small tobacco shop in a remote part of Western Tokyo—about 1.5km from Musashi-Koganei station—went viral, hitting the front page of Reddit and beyond.

According to the owner of the shop, tourists would make the trek from all over the world just to meet Shiba-San, who would, in turn, greet them with only the enthusiasm a canine employee could:

But the shopkeepers recently announced that they permanently shut their doors on October 30—and, yes, Shiba-San has retired as well.
